The growing dependence on fiber optic networks has boosted focus on every detail of installment, including the quality and compatibility of the elements used to develop those systems. A micro duct connector is made to join two micro ducts safely, developing a path where fiber wires can be blown or pushed with marginal resistance. In many situations, micro air ducts are preferred because they enable installers to position numerous future-ready pathways into a fairly tiny space, which is particularly beneficial in stuffed urban environments where underground genuine estate is restricted. The connector's job is uncomplicated in concept, yet its importance is significant: it should produce an exact, long lasting, and impermeable link that sustains low-friction cable installation and long-lasting dependability. If the connector stops working, the entire duct path can become compromised, affecting solution top quality and raising upkeep expenses.

Among the main factors micro duct adapters have become so extensively utilized is that they help streamline network growth. Traditional wire laying techniques frequently call for more intrusive excavation, even more labor, and a bigger commitment to the last route prior to the network is also completely needed. Micro duct systems, by comparison, enable operators to mount a network of pathways beforehand and afterwards add fiber when need boosts. The connector makes this modular approach feasible by joining areas cleanly and efficiently. This indicates that infrastructure organizers can develop with scalability in mind, lowering the risk of overbuilding while still planning for future demands. For telecommunications providers, communities, and private designers, this flexibility is a major benefit in an era where connection requires can enhance swiftly and unexpectedly.

The style of a micro duct connector is frequently optimized for rate, protection, and compatibility with a variety of duct sizes. Many versions are engineered to develop a mechanical seal without needing complicated tools, which lowers setup time and lowers the opportunity of human mistake. The connector needs to hold firmly sufficient to stop separation under stress or ecological stress, yet it should also enable straightforward setting up in the area. This balance in between toughness and convenience of use is main to its value. Installers usually function under time pressure and in challenging conditions, and a connector that is reliable and instinctive can make a meaningful distinction in task effectiveness. In large deployments, even small time financial savings per connection can equate right into significant reductions in labor prices and project timelines.

One more essential quality of micro duct ports is their capability to support clean, protected atmospheres for fiber setup. Fiber optic cords are extremely conscious bending, crushing, and contamination. A well-made connector aids preserve the interior integrity of the duct course by making certain that the signed up with sections remain aligned and safe and secure. This placement is important since any obstruction or abnormality can interfere with cable television blowing efficiency and possibly damage the cable itself. The connector therefore acts not equally as a physical joiner however as a safeguard for the fragile facilities it supports. In this feeling, the connector contributes to both prompt setup success and long-term operational integrity.

Ecological resistance is another element that affects the quality and efficiency of a micro duct connector. Underground and exterior network setups are subjected to dampness, soil movement, temperature level variant, and sometimes chemical exposure. The connector should be developed from materials with the ability of withstanding these conditions without breaking down, fracturing, or helping to loosen over time. In many installations, airtight and watertight performance is particularly crucial since water invasion can endanger cable television performance and enhance the risk of service blackouts. By maintaining a protected connection, the connector assists safeguard the wider system from environmental hazards. This strength is specifically useful in regions with harsh climate, changing ground conditions, or high levels of dampness.
